a,abbr,acronym,address,applet,article,aside,audio,b,big,blockquote,body,canvas,caption,center,cite,code,dd,del,details,dfn,div,dl,dt,em,embed,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hgroup,html,i,iframe,img,ins,kbd,label,legend,li,mark,menu,nav,object,ol,output,p,pre,q,ruby,s,samp,section,small,span,strike,strong,sub,summary,sup,table,tbody,td,tfoot,th,thead,time,tr,tt,u,ul,var,video{border:0;font-size:100%;font:inherit;margin:0;padding:0;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:"";content:none}table{border-collapse:collapse;border-spacing:0}*{box-sizing:border-box}:root{--red:#e1261c;--red-dark:#ad1b14;--red-hover:#c91f17;--el-color-primary:#e1261c;--el-color-primary-light-3:#ea6860;--el-color-primary-light-5:#f0928d;--el-color-primary-light-7:#f6bdb9;--el-color-primary-light-8:#f9d4d2;--el-color-primary-light-9:#fce9e8;--el-color-primary-dark-2:#b41e16;--el-border-radius-base:6px;--el-font-family:var(--font);--ink:#171717;--text:#404040;--muted:#737373;--placeholder:#a3a3a3;--line:#e5e5e5;--line-light:#eee;--soft:#f7f8fa;--muted-bg:#f5f5f5;--soft-red:#fff2f1;--card:#fff;--mask:rgba(0,0,0,.56);--radius:8px;--radius-sm:6px;--radius-lg:12px;--radius-xl:16px;--shadow:0 16px 48px rgba(0,0,0,.12);--sh-sm:0 1px 3px rgba(0,0,0,.06);--sh-md:0 8px 24px rgba(0,0,0,.08);--sh-lg:0 16px 48px rgba(0,0,0,.12);--sh-xl:0 26px 64px rgba(17,24,39,.16);--font-en:"Inter",system-ui,sans-serif;--font-zh:"Noto Sans SC","PingFang SC","Microsoft YaHei",sans-serif;--font:var(--font-en),var(--font-zh);--container-width:1320px;--container-wide-width:1440px;--container-padding:32px;--space-2:2px;--space-4:4px;--space-6:6px;--space-8:8px;--space-10:10px;--space-12:12px;--space-14:14px;--space-16:16px;--space-18:18px;--space-20:20px;--space-22:22px;--space-24:24px;--space-28:28px;--space-32:32px;--space-36:36px;--space-40:40px;--space-48:48px;--space-64:64px;--section-pad-y:88px;--section-pad-y-sm:48px;--hero-pad:32px 20px;--card-pad:20px;--card-pad-sm:16px;--card-pad-lg:24px;--fs-display:76px;--fs-hero:52px;--fs-page-hero:52px;--fs-hero-sub:18px;--fs-section:38px;--fs-section-sm:32px;--fs-lead:18px;--fs-overline:10px;--fs-card-title:18px;--fs-body:16px;--fs-body-lg:17px;--fs-title-xs:19px;--fs-title-sm:20px;--fs-title-md:22px;--fs-title-lg:24px;--fs-title-xl:26px;--fs-title-2xl:28px;--fs-title-3xl:30px;--fs-title-4xl:32px;--fs-ui:14px;--fs-ui-lg:15px;--fs-small:13px;--fs-note:13.5px;--fs-caption:12px;--fs-stat:58px;--fs-stat-lg:64px;--fs-statement:72px;--fs-watermark:104px;--lh-tight:1.15;--lh-heading:1.25;--lh-body:1.72;--lh-zh:1.85;--fw-normal:400;--fw-medium:500;--fw-semibold:600;--fw-bold:700;--fw-black:900;--breakpoint-mobile:767.98px}@media(max-width:768px){:root{--container-padding:16px;--fs-display:40px;--fs-hero:32px;--fs-page-hero:32px;--fs-hero-sub:18px;--fs-section:26px;--fs-section-sm:24px;--fs-lead:16px;--fs-card-title:16px;--fs-body:15px;--fs-body-lg:16px;--fs-title-xs:18px;--fs-title-sm:20px;--fs-title-md:22px;--fs-title-lg:24px;--fs-title-xl:26px;--fs-title-2xl:28px;--fs-title-3xl:30px;--fs-title-4xl:32px;--fs-ui:14px;--fs-ui-lg:15px;--fs-small:13px;--fs-note:13px;--fs-caption:12px;--fs-stat:42px;--fs-stat-lg:48px;--fs-statement:40px;--fs-watermark:64px;--lh-body:1.73;--lh-zh:1.8}}html{font-size:16px;min-width:320px;overflow-x:hidden;scroll-behavior:smooth;-moz-text-size-adjust:100%;text-size-adjust:100%;-webkit-text-size-adjust:100%}[id]{scroll-margin-top:132px}body{background:#fff;color:var(--text);font-size:var(--fs-body);line-height:var(--lh-body);margin:0;min-width:320px;overflow-x:hidden;padding-top:114px;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ility}body,button,input,select,textarea{font-family:var(--font)}button{background:none;border:0;cursor:pointer;padding:0}h1,h2,h3,h4,h5,h6{color:var(--ink);font-family:var(--font);font-weight:var(--fw-black);letter-spacing:0;line-height:var(--lh-heading)}b,strong{font-weight:var(--fw-bold)}p{line-height:var(--lh-zh)}a{color:inherit;text-decoration:none}img{display:block;height:auto;max-width:100%}@media(max-width:768px){html{scroll-behavior:auto}[id]{scroll-margin-top:64px}body{padding-top:46px}input,select,textarea{font-size:16px}}.container{max-width:var(--container-width)}.container,.container-wide{margin:0 auto;padding-left:var(--container-padding);padding-right:var(--container-padding);width:100%}.container-wide{max-width:var(--container-wide-width)}.pc-only{display:block}.mobile-only{display:none}@media(max-width:768px){.pc-only{display:none!important}.mobile-only{display:block!important}}.btn,.btn-dark,.btn-ghost,.btn-primary{align-items:center;border:1px solid transparent;border-radius:6px;cursor:pointer;display:inline-flex;font-size:var(--fs-ui);font-weight:800;justify-content:center;line-height:1.2;min-height:42px;padding:0 18px;text-decoration:none;white-space:nowrap}.btn-primary{background:var(--red);box-shadow:0 12px 26px #e1261c3d;color:#fff}.btn-primary:hover{background:var(--red-hover)}.btn-ghost{background:#fff;border-color:var(--line);color:var(--ink)}.btn-dark{background:var(--ink);color:#fff}.btn-dark:focus-visible,.btn-ghost:focus-visible,.btn-primary:focus-visible,.btn:focus-visible{outline:3px solid rgba(225,38,28,.22);outline-offset:3px}@media(max-width:768px){.btn,.btn-dark,.btn-ghost,.btn-primary{font-size:14px;min-height:42px;padding-left:18px;padding-right:18px}}@media(prefers-reduced-motion:reduce){*,:after,:before{animation-duration:.01ms!important;animation-iteration-count:1!important;scroll-behavior:auto!important;transition-duration:.01ms!important}}.error-page[data-v-afbd8211]{background:#fff}.error-hero[data-v-afbd8211]{align-items:center;background:linear-gradient(90deg,#111827e0,#1118279e),url(../images/cargo-ship.jpg) 50% /cover;color:#fff;display:flex;min-height:560px;padding:92px 0}.error-code[data-v-afbd8211]{color:#ffddd9;font-size:15px;font-weight:900;letter-spacing:.16em;margin:0}.error-hero h1[data-v-afbd8211]{color:#fff;font-size:64px;line-height:1.08;margin:18px 0 0;max-width:760px}.error-message[data-v-afbd8211]{color:#ffffffd6;font-size:18px;margin:20px 0 0;max-width:700px}.error-actions[data-v-afbd8211]{display:flex;flex-wrap:wrap;gap:var(--space-12);margin-top:30px}.error-actions .btn-ghost[data-v-afbd8211],.error-actions .btn-primary[data-v-afbd8211]{cursor:pointer}@media(max-width:768px){.error-hero[data-v-afbd8211]{min-height:500px;padding:72px 0}.error-hero h1[data-v-afbd8211]{font-size:36px;line-height:1.18}.error-message[data-v-afbd8211]{font-size:16px}}
